MEMO — Discount Policy, Large Deals

To all branch managers: effective immediately, deals above 250 units require regional approval before any discount over 8%. Standing 12% authority is withdrawn. Log every exception in the Fernhollow tracker. Non-compliant quotes will be voided. This change supports the plan summarised in the confidential note below.

internal memo for hahif-hahaf: Headcount on the Zorwyn team goes from 9 to 100 by the end of October. Gross margin on Zorwyn came in at 5 percent against a plan of 10 percent.

INTERNAL MEMO — Sales Leads, Brackwell Instruments

From next quarter we are launching a tiered reseller programme for the Ostrel product line. Partners will be grouped into Core and Select bands, with margin differentials of roughly five points. Onboarding is handled by the channel team in the Fennick office; training packs ship in two weeks. Do not extend provisional terms to any partner before certification completes. Expect questions about exclusivity — hold firm until guidance lands. Context on the wider strategy appears directly below.

management briefing: The renewal with Zoraelax Group closes at $10 million a year, 15 percent below the last contract. Project Ralael slips by six weeks because of the audit delay.

**Ticket: Tide widget drift on Gullport kiosks**

Hey team — the TideGlance widget on the Gullport harbor kiosks is showing different refresh behavior than the ones in Marrow Bay, and customers noticed the predictions lag by an hour. Looks like classic config drift: someone hand-edited the kiosk fleet back in spring and it never got synced to the template. Please compare each kiosk against the canonical settings and flag mismatches. For reference, the canonical deployment uses the following values.

settings of yageg-yahap:
[gorael]
team = olieth
access_code = ac_941d74
owner = brieth.aldiel
host = gorael.tolvaqio.internal
port = 6379
peer = briwyn.urlaqtech.internal
salt = 116e6622
pin = 1957

Shared Lab Access — Visitor Policy. Lab 4B at the Ostrander Campus is shared between our Materials group and the Fennick Institute's coatings team. Visitors hosted by either party must be logged at the facilities desk and escorted at all times; Fennick staff are not authorised to sign in our visitors, and vice versa. Equipment bookings take precedence over tours. When escorting an approved visitor into 4B, desk staff should unlock the interlock panel using the code below.

turnstile pass: bdg-TXR-4